A DIFFERENT VIEW: Looking towards St. Peter's in Rome
Looking towards St. Peter's Basilica, Rome.
A little different of a street corner cityscape then the prior post of Toronto. This same view has existed for hundreds of years, barely changed other than the fashion of the pedestrians and the mode of vehicles. This picture was taken in 1990 and I remember thinking it was so intense that I was seeing almost the exact view as was scene by visitors to Rome during the Renaissance.
